Criminal Appeals: Disaster Preparedness: Making a Record and Protecting Your Client While Thinking About Appeals; 2024 Trial Skills Update Seminar

This session will introduce trial lawyers to the appellate process. It will focus on foundational principles governing criminal appeals and on the various standards of appellate review. It seeks to help trial lawyers think not only of how to be effective advocates in the courtroom, but also of what they can do before, during, and after a trial to preserve issues for appeal and maximize the chances of having an unfavorable trial outcome reversed.
